Physician-scientist Yu Chen studies the role of transcription factors that are critical for prostate cancer development.
… The major goal of my laboratory is to understand how critical transcription factors mediate prostate cancer oncogenesis. Physician-scientist Liang Deng studies poxvirus interface with the immune system and the development of poxviruses as oncolytic and immunotherapy for cancers.
… Our laboratory is focused on understanding how poxviruses are detected by the host innate immune sensing mechanisms and how poxviruses evade host antiviral responses.
